What is ZoomInfo?

ZoomInfo is a comprehensive go-to-market intelligence platform designed to help revenue teams find, engage, and close their most valuable buyers. It combines a proprietary commercial search engine with AI-driven datasets, supporting sales, marketing, operations, and talent acquisition with accurate, up-to-date B2B contact and company information. By uniting teams around a single source of truth, ZoomInfo streamlines outreach, automates tasks, and accelerates deal cycles.

ZoomInfo Overview

Founded in 2007, ZoomInfo started as a simple contact database and has evolved into a multi-platform operating system for revenue teams. Their mission: eliminate outdated spreadsheets and siloed tools that hinder GTM efficiency. Over the years, ZoomInfo secured major funding rounds, acquired leading conversation intelligence and data orchestration companies (like Chorus and Clickagy), and expanded its AI capabilities with ZoomInfo Copilot.

Today, ZoomInfo serves over 20,000 customers globally, from B2B startups to Fortune 500 enterprises. Their platform covers Sales, Marketing, Operations, Data as a Service (DaaS), and Talent solutions—all built on a foundation of trusted data and powered by continuous machine learning updates.

Features

ZoomInfo’s feature set spans multiple modules—each tailored to specific GTM roles:

ZoomInfo Sales

Intelligence and prospecting tools for sales teams:

  • Advanced search filters to identify high-value prospects.
  • Intent data signals to prioritize accounts demonstrating active buying interest.
  • Conversation intelligence (Chorus) that analyzes call recordings for coaching insights.

ZoomInfo Marketing

ABM and conversion tools designed for modern demand gen:

  • Account scoring based on firmographic and technographic data.
  • Targeted ad campaign integrations and ROI tracking.
  • Web chat powered by real-time prospect identification.

ZoomInfo Operations

No-code data management and orchestration for ops teams:

  • Automated data cleansing and enrichment workflows.
  • Custom integrations with CRM, MAP, and business intelligence tools.
  • Centralized data governance to ensure compliance.

ZoomInfo DaaS

APIs and bulk data access for data teams:

  • Customizable data delivery via RESTful APIs.
  • Scheduled bulk exports for periodic updates.
  • High-volume enrichment pipelines for enterprise use cases.

ZoomInfo Talent

Recruitment database and engagement platform:

  • Access to millions of candidate profiles with verified contact info.
  • Email sequence automation to streamline outreach.
  • Analytics on outreach performance and candidate engagement.

ZoomInfo Pricing

ZoomInfo offers tiered plans tailored to team size and use case complexity. Exact figures vary by contract size and add-ons, but here’s a general breakdown:

Professional Plan

Ideal for small sales or marketing teams launching basic outreach.

  • Core contact and company database.
  • Email and phone prospecting credits.
  • Standard data enrichment.

Advanced Plan

Best for mid-market teams needing automation and intent data.

  • All Professional features plus intent signals.
  • Conversation intelligence (Chorus).
  • Web chat and engagement analytics.

Elite Plan

Designed for enterprise with custom workflows and DaaS integration.

  • Full suite access: Sales, Marketing, Operations, Talent.
  • Unlimited enrichment and advanced API usage.
  • Dedicated support and onboarding resources.
